AIM/INTRODUCTION: Analgesic, anti-inflammatory and anti-apoptotic effects of pregabalin have been shown previously. In this study, we investigated the protective effect of different doses of pregabalin on skeletal muscle IR injury in rats. MATERIALS AND METHODS: 24 rats were randomly divided into 4 groups (Control, Ischaemia-Reperfusion (IR), IR-Pregabalin 50 mg, IR-Pregabalin 200 mg). Following IR, serum Ischemia Modified Albumin (IMA) and tissue Paraoxonase (PON) were studied and gastrocnemius muscle tissue was removed for histopathologic examination. RESULTS: Interstitial inflammation was higher in the IR group than in the control and Pregabalin 200 mg groups (p = 0.037, p = 0.037, respectively). Congestion was higher in the IR group than in the control, Pregabalin 50 and 200 mg groups (p = 0.001, p = 0.004, p = 0.004, respectively). PON was lower in the IR group than in the Control, Pregabalin 50 and 200 mg groups (p = 0.001, p = 0.007, p = 0.015, respectively). IMA was higher in the IR group than in the Control, Pregabalin 50 and 200 mg groups (p < 0.0001, all). CONCLUSION: We think that administration of pregabalin, more prominent at 200 mg, can reverse the injury that occurs in the skeletal muscle of IR-induced rats. Pregabalin can be safely used for analgesia in cases of IR (Tab. 2, Fig. 9, Ref. 41).
